Understand the laws governing warrants' public disclosure and how to check for active warrants in Ohio including details on online searches, access to public records, and the duration of warrant validity.Apr 16, 2024 · Bench warrants in Ohio are commonly issued when individuals fail to appear in court as scheduled. This might include missing a hearing related to a criminal case, violating the terms of probation, or not showing up for a court-mandated appointment.

Statute of limitations for criminal offenses. (A) (1) Except as provided in division (A) (2), (3), (4), or (5) of this section or as otherwise provided in this section, a prosecution shall be barred unless it is commenced within the following periods after an offense is committed: (a) For a felony, six years;

NOPEC’s mission is to provide reliable, cost-eff...Morrow County, Ohio Morrow County is a county located in the state of Ohio, United States. Shawnee people used the area for hunting purposes before white settlers arrived in the early 19th century. Morrow County was organized in 1848 from parts of four neighboring counties and named for Jeremiah Morrow, Governor of Ohio from 1822 to 1826.…
